CITY OF WINTER HAVEN SOCIAL MEDIA POLICY

Under Florida law, all content on the Department's page is subject to public records law, Chapter 119, Florida Statutes. By becoming a fan or friend your information will be a matter of public record. Social Media Posting Policy:
We encourage the public to share thoughts as they relate to the topic being discussed. We welcome your comments, but w

e expect comments generally to be courteous, follow our rules of decorum, and be related to the posting being discussed. To that end, we have established the following policy and we reserve the discretion to hide/remove comments that:
contain obscene, indecent, or profane language; contain threats or defamatory statements; are bullying, intimidating, or harassing any user; contain personal attacks; contain hate speech; promote or endorse services or products; suggest or encourage illegal activity; are multiple, repetitive off-topic posts by a single user (spam); are not topically related to the particular posting; or violate a legal ownership interest of any other party. The rules of decorum are in place to encourage civil discourse and to prevent a poster from disrupting dialog in a way that prevents or impedes the accomplishment of the purpose of any of our social media sites including Facebook, YouTube, and Twitter. Our purpose is to convey important public information, increase our ability to quickly, effectively, and efficiently reach and engage the citizens of Winter Haven to further our mission in creating a preferred place in which to live, work, play, learn and raise a family.

The Winter Haven Recreation & Cultural Center Branch Library is now open to the public! Located at 801 MLK Blvd., this neighborhood branch is open Monday through Friday from 9 am to 6 pm, and Saturday from 10 am to 5 pm. Browse a curated collection of books for all ages, check out laptops for in-library use, and faxing and printing services will be available soon.
